Viscosity monotype with Akua inks involves a loose, painterly, and often, thrilling exploration playing the edge between accident and control. Create subtle, spontaneous, one-of-a kind prints, using modified inks. Thick and thin inks resist each other in ways that allow for beautiful color interactions in delightfully unpredictable ways. Learn some of the tricks to making this fun way of exploring color work for you, as you add to your printing vocabulary.

Demonstrations will include best modifiers to alter the viscosity of these inks, how to create liquid masks to keep areas of the plate free of ink, and simple offset rolling methods.
This workshop is open to beginners with no printmaking experience as well as experienced printmakers. It can also be used as an introduction or a re-fresher course for those familiar with monotype printmaking and how to work with Akua Intaglio Inks.

About the Instructor:

Joyce Silverstone is a graduate and traveling fellow of The School of the Museum of Fine Arts, Boston. Her current body of work and her workshop teaching centers around layered multiple plate printing using monotype inking methods.
